We created many multi-image, multi-media presentations which relied on a musical "bed" created from discs of licensed public domain recordings. I filled out a licensing form, listing the music used, its intended purpose and estimated audience. We calculated the fee, and submitted it to CAPAC, the Canadian musical rights police :-). Because groups like CAPAC existed, and because they were agressive in hunting down non-fee-payers, I was in a good position to ask for and receive accesss to the types of music I needed to create the kind of shows my employees wanted. I was also able to withstand some pressure from my immediate boss to "fudge" the reports to save money and to put together "quickies" that reflected poorly on our department--or at least to let them exist beyond the _one time only_ use they were supposedly made for. Mr. Mora's program isn't a "search and destroy" type of thing; it is an auditing tool to assist in determining which programs are being used, so that honest companies can enable their employees to have the needed tools to do their jobs.
